GENERAL SUMMARY:

The person selected for this position must be a friendly, mature and responsible person. The candidate must have the ability to work well with children in a childcare setting and already be in possession of the State of Illinois Food and Sanitation License. This person will open the Center and be the morning assistant prior to assuming the cooking role. The Cook is responsible for ensuring children are served nutritious, good tasting and appealing meals and snacks. It is the Cook’s responsibility to prepare these meals and snacks by methods that maintain high nutrient levels and that are sanitary. It is also the Cook’s duty to deliver meals to the classroom ready for family style meal service and suitable for the children’s age and development.

EMPLOYMENT QUALIFICATIONS/EDUCATION:

It is preferred that the Cook have course work and training in foods, nutrition and/or dietetics. It is also preferred that the Cook possess a current Food Manager Certificate at the time of hiring.

EXPERIENCE:

Possess knowledge of the principles and practices and current state of child nutrition and of the eating habits of the children served in the program. Demonstrated skills in preparing these foods in a nutritious, good tasting and appealing manner. Experience in child food service preparation and management desirable. Knowledge of CACFP requirements also desirable. Effective oral and written communication skills commensurate with the responsibilities of the position are required.

Responsibilities
  • Dependability to open the Center
  • Work will with children
  • Maintains established standards of sanitation, safety and food preparation and storage as set by the local and state health departments; maintains an orderly, sanitary, and safe kitchen.
  • Cook and serve breakfast
  • Cook and serve lunch
  • Cook/prepare and serve snack
  • Must be an effective team player
  • Assist children as needed
  • Must be able to multi-task effectively
  • Comply with the Food Program requirements
  • Develop menus according to requirements set by the state
  • Wear hairnet daily while cooking and preparing food
  • Adhere to scheduled serving times
  • Maintain the cleanliness of the kitchen area including appliances
  • Maintain the cleanliness of all areas related to food service
  • Performs other duties, as assigned.
  • Complete daily/weekly cleaning schedule
  • Have Physical capabilities – Must be able to lift 45lbs on a daily basis, numerous times a day
